#d65796 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d65796 is composed of 83.9% red, 34.1%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.3% magenta, 29.9%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 330.2 degrees, a saturation of 60.8% and a lightness of 59%. #d65796 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aeff with #ad002d.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#d65796 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d65796 has RGB values of R:214, G:87,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.59, Y:0.3,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14047126.

Shades and Tints of #d65796
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050103 is the darkest color, while #fcf5f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d65796
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9e8f96 is the less saturated color, while #fe2f96 is the most saturated one.
